As a traditional Chinese medicine, Panax notoginseng(Sanchi) is well-known for its remarkable efficacy in treating cardiovascular diseases.
And with the improvement of modern extraction technology, its efficacy has been greatly improved. Panax notoginseng extract, total saponins and its effective extracted components have an auxiliary effect in the treatment of cardiovascular diseases.
